    Jasper's is a bar and restaurant on 9th Ave in Hell's Kitchen. The decor is a little bit rustic, in a comforting way that feels welcoming and genuine. Over the past year living in the area, Jasper's has become one of my favorite places for tasty food and happy hour drinks. Let's discuss the deals, since they are pretty awesome: there's the aforementioned happy hour, during which many drinks are cheap and some are a downright steal; Taco Tuesday, where short rib or fish tacos pair with discounted margs, mules, and tequila shots; and Wing Wednesday, when wings are half-priced all day. These enticing discounts are a wonderful way to enjoy great food and drink without breaking the bank. That said, there's some good stuff on the full menu, such as the ribs (fall-off-the-bone tender) and the buffalo chicken salad. Meanwhile, the tap selection covers a range of local and regional craft beers, perfect for anyone seeking a cold pint. A recent tap takeover from Keg & Lantern was well-received by this reviewer. On top of that, the service is always terrific. Keeps me coming back. Jasper's is a fun place where pleasant memories are formed.

    What a gorgeous bar to celebrate the man, the myth, the legend. I had just reread The Picture of…read moreDorian Gray with my book club so this was a fitting experience. The interior is beautiful, every corner is eye catching. They even have a screen that showcases his famous quotes. They have an extensive drink menu with themed cocktails. It was busy so things might get a bit delayed but the staff was nice. We ordered a bunch of cocktails. The Exile- This is a sweet and refreshing drink with raspberries, strawberries, vodka, and finished with greek mastiha mint. Secret Knock- This is a smoky drink with a bit of a bite. You get peach liqueur with cinnamon smoke, bitters, and yellowstone bourbon. Robbie's Reverie- This starts with violet gin, lemon, rhubarb, and tonic. Strong and citrusy. Devil's Kiss- You start with tempranillo, a little bit of strawberry apertif and orange liqueur, Finished with blackcurrant and brandy. Fruity with a kick. Great experience overall!
